On May 29, 2013, we hosted the Rosenfeld Media virtual webinar “31 Practical UX Tips” (archive) for the User Experience Toledo Region community.
- What: 31 Practical UX Tips from well-known UX experts. 6 hours of presentations to help you improve the quality of experiences you design.
- When: Wednesday, May 29th, 2013, from 9am to 5pm.
- Where: BGSU at Levis Commons.
- Who: Companies & organizations in the region who want to give their employees, clients or members top-notch education about user experience, without the expense or bother of traveling to a conference.
- Why: These UX tips will help you make better software, sell more products, and have happier customers.
Sponsors bought packages of 4 tickets for $100. Individuals could also buy tickets for $30. Lunch, sandwiches from JB’s Sarnie Shoppe, was included.
Program
- Steve Krug, Don’t Make Me Think, usability tips
- Whitney Quesenbery, Storytelling for UX, content tips
- Jeffrey Eisenberg, Waiting For Your Cat to Bark?, marketing tips
- Susan Weinschenk, Neuro Web Design, psychology tips
- Aarron Walter, Designing for Emotion, user data tips
- Luke Wroblewski, Web Form Design, interaction tips
